From: Xuehan Xu Date: Mon, 11 Dec 2023 02:23:36 +0000 (+0800) Subject: crimson/os/seastore/transaction_manager: fix errorator mismatch X-Git-Tag: v19.3.0~72^2~2 X-Git-Url: http://git-server-git.apps.pok.os.sepia.ceph.com/?a=commitdiff_plain;h=cf509b1933bdba9028501cedf45d9ce757d9995e;p=ceph.git crimson/os/seastore/transaction_manager: fix errorator mismatch Signed-off-by: Xuehan Xu --- diff --git a/src/crimson/os/seastore/transaction_manager.h b/src/crimson/os/seastore/transaction_manager.h index 7720469c2821..640b98f79426 100644 --- a/src/crimson/os/seastore/transaction_manager.h +++ b/src/crimson/os/seastore/transaction_manager.h @@ -384,7 +384,7 @@ public: return this->read_pin(t, std::move(pin)); }).si_then([this, &t](auto extent) { auto ext = get_mutable_extent(t, extent)->template cast(); - return alloc_extent_iertr::make_ready_future>( + return read_extent_iertr::make_ready_future>( std::move(ext)); }); }